In this podcast, Dr. Lisa Dunne offers a social science perspective on the concept of relational development. Drawing from studies like Knapp's Stages of Relational Development and modern neuroscience research on the bonding hormone, oxytocin, Dr. Dunne shows how we can take simple, practical steps toward building a healthy relational base -- and why this type of community is vital to our emotional, mental, and physiological well-being. In an era where loneliness and isolation have reached epidemic proportions at the global level, this podcast offers helpful step-by-step solutions for positive change founded in both experiential learning and the trusted academic literature of theology, psychology, and neuroscience.
